Jackie Kennedy was a very well educated lady from a high class society family. She saved many of the beautiful antiques in the White House basement and updated the public areas. She also hosted a wonderful TV special of a tour of the redecorated White House.

Melania Trump can in NO WAY be compared with Jackie Kennedy, who spoke fluent French and Spanish (not Slovakian!). Jackie was so popular in France that President Kennedy began a speech in France saying that he "was the man who accompanied Jackie Kennedy to France."
